The 2023 Honda CR-V has begin closing the gap to the Haval H6 in Thailand's C-SUV sales for the month of April 2023, garnering 446 units sold to the H6's 401 cars moved. Autolife's sales data points towards Honda gaining ground after falling behind its Chinese rival in Q1 2023. Despite regaining the top spot for the month, there's still work to be done as the year-to-date lead still goes to Haval with 1,585 H6 sold thus far against the Honda's 654 cars. During the launch of the Ora Good Cat today, the ASEAN Region President of Great Wall Motor (GWM), Elliot Zhang shared that the company will be commencing local production (CKD) in Malaysia beginning 2023, and we can expect more cars from them in the near future too. Zhang mentioned that the introduction of the CKD project will create more than 2,000 jobs. At Chery’s preview event announcing the brand’s official return to Malaysia, the director of Chery Malaysia said that it's the first ASEAN appearance of the Chery Tiggo 8 Pro e+ plug-in hybrid (PHEV). The Chery Tiggo 8 Pro e+ has a 1.5-litre turbocharged petrol engine supplemented by two electric motors to give a maximum torque of 510 Nm, while power figure was not divulged.
